Output 750c76c28323329cbbf0cddbd24bd8c67fa2c6242df5ab58540b000b181d3d88:1

value
1053548
script pubkey
OP_0 OP_PUSHBYTES_32 3677f5fe8430199745b0b3819d5eaa157897f74eb458d47712f2e4d783dda32a
address
bc1qxemltl5yxqvew3dskwqe6h42z4uf0a6wk3vdgacj7tjd0q7a5v4qfs4h6n
transaction
750c76c28323329cbbf0cddbd24bd8c67fa2c6242df5ab58540b000b181d3d88
spent
true